android禁止软键盘
❶ 怎么设置android 键盘输入法禁止关闭
关掉android手机软键盘打字的声音: 1.打开【设定】。 2.打开【声音】。 3.找到【拨号键盘音】和【触摸声音】,将勾去掉即可。 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和...
❷ Android有AutoCompleteTextView有没有什么办法关闭软键盘
导入包啊
textview
和
button
都不在你的这个的包下
你用鼠标放在红叉那里
会给你提示
让你导入包的
❸ 安卓手机虚拟键盘怎么关闭
1、以华为p20手机为例,首先在手机桌面中找到设置图标,点击进入。
❹ android 软键盘什么时候关闭
软键盘的关闭
首页是scrollView 包裹的界面,滚动一段距离后进入下一个页面,会弹出软键盘
当关闭该界面的时候 直接 finish()
回到首页的时候,scrollView 不是原来的位置了
❺ android自定义软键盘,如何屏蔽系统自带键盘
在需要的地方加上以下代码就行了
In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E);
if (imm != null) {
imm.hideSoftInputFromWindow(view.getWindowToken(), 0);
}
view是你的某个控件,放在onClickListener中就可以屏蔽单击时的键盘了
❻ android中怎么用代码实现 隐藏 软键盘
在Android开发中,经常会有一个需求,做完某项操作后,隐藏键盘,也即让Android中的软键盘不显示。今天,和大家分享如何利用代码来实现对Android的软件盘的隐藏、显示的操作,并给出Demo参考。
1.切换显示软键盘
这个效果是:如果有软键盘,那么隐藏它;反之,把它显示出来。代码方法如下:
//1.得到InputMethodManager对象
In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E);
//2.调用toggleSoftInput方法,实现切换显示软键盘的功能。
imm.toggleSoftInput(0, InputMethodManager.HIDE_NOT_ALWAYS);
2.显示软键盘
//1.得到InputMethodManager对象
In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E);
//2.调用showSoftInput方法显示软键盘,其中view为聚焦的view组件
imm.showSoftInput(view,InputMethodManager.SHOW_FORCED);
3.隐藏软键盘
//1.得到InputMethodManager对象
InputMethodManager imm = (InputMethodManager) getSystemService(Context.INPUT_METHOD_SERVICE);
//2.调用hideSoftInputFromWindow方法隐藏软键盘
imm.hideSoftInputFromWindow(view.getWindowToken(), 0); //强制隐藏键盘
4.获取输入法打开的状态
//1.得到InputMethodManager对象
InputMethodManager imm = (InputMethodManager)getSystemService(Context.INPUT_METHOD_SERVICE);
//获取状态信息
boolean isOpen=imm.isActive();//isOpen若返回true,则表示输入法打开
❼ Android在开发的时候如何屏蔽系统自带软键盘!怎样书写代码
怎样隐藏这些虚拟按键啊 坐等大神
❽ android4.4 framework层怎样阻止弹出软键盘(输入法)
我建议你先下载一个任意的第三方输入法 然后按照步骤安装 屏蔽原机自带输入法 然后删除第三方输入法 这时候 你再打开要输入的一个界面 光标点击空白处 你会发现没有任何软键盘弹出 希望对你有帮助
❾ 如何禁止android软键盘自动弹出
在开发Anroid的时候,当你打开一个界面的时候,屏幕的焦点会自动停留在第一个EditText中,Android的软键盘默认会自动弹出,用户第一眼连界面都没有看清楚,软键盘就弹出来了,这就影响到了用户体验,我们需要设置打开界面的时候,当EditText获取焦点的时候,不弹出软键盘,其实也很简单,代码如下://
默认软键盘不弹出
getWindow().setSoftInputMode(
WindowManager.LayoutParams.SOFT_INPUT_STATE_HIDDEN);
在OnCreate()函数中,加上即可,OK,搞定。